"Tales of the Forgotten," released in 2025, is an engaging adventure game that invites players to explore three chilling ghost stories set in everyday locations. With its PSX-style environments and first-person perspective, the game immerses you in suspenseful moments filled with jump scares and surreal experiences. As you navigate these haunting tales, the ability to unlock multiple endings adds depth to the narrative, making it a unique entry in the adventure genre.
